What Is Rejoice & Renew! All About?

What is the importance of Rejoice & Renew! for First Presbyterian Church? 

Worship is central to all we are and all we do.  Our Book of Order reminds us “the life of the Christian flows from the worship of the church.”  The projects in this campaign will enable our congregation to incorporate new energy and excitement into our worship and bring a sense of community to all our worship experiences. The goals of Rejoice & Renew! are to help us:

·         Glorify God through simple and practical beauty;
·        
Proclaim the Word;
·        
Celebrate the sacraments;
·        
Enjoy music and liturgy in all their forms.

What, specifically, will this entail?

We will renovate the sanctuary by enlarging the chancel.  This will allow for more flexibility in all forms of worship.  The baptismal font, pulpit, and communion table will be more prominent and central to our worship. We will be able to accommodate, see and hear the special presentations of our children and youth.  And, to fulfill a long-standing need, the new space will accommodate a new organ.

 Why do we need a new organ? 

Our current organ, built in 1954, has served us well, but over its five decades of service it has become inadequate in many ways.  It is beyond repair.  The organ is a fundamental part of our worship tradition and our church celebrations.  A new organ will inspire our worship.       

 Why do we need the renovations to the sanctuary?

The committee that was formed in 2001 originally focused upon organ construction and restoration.  However, they soon realized that this was an opportune time to study the importance and role of FPC’s various worship experiences.  The proposed plan to renovate the sanctuary not only supports greater and varied worship experiences; it also draws attention to the significance of the elements of Presbyterian theology and worship.
